    Whipple 3v supercharger

    I would say that 450 rwhp is a safe limit for stock rods though I ran closer to 500 for many years with my whipple. I have since backed the timing off and figure I'm around 465. With conservative timing I think were pretty safe up to 500 but it needs to be a spot on tune.

    Catch can for paxton sc?

    You should remove the pcv valve if you are going to go with breathers. If you don't it well never vent out of that side because it needs vacuum to open up. Now in most cases it wouldn't be an issue and the PS and oil cap would be sufficient. But with the added cylinder head pressure from the...
